Output 0731f20d17e48213f4feabf2a4fd0c73145137896be9752d50569c97cb17ff46:0

value
512502
script pubkey
OP_0 OP_PUSHBYTES_20 b70e0323e7ffb1fe27c2589f13b494c17e01e8e5
address
bc1qku8qxgl8l7cluf7ztz038dy5c9lqr689dxqsz0
transaction
0731f20d17e48213f4feabf2a4fd0c73145137896be9752d50569c97cb17ff46
confirmations
108786
spent
true